Protein Linking and Labeling Systems
Protein linking and labeling systems provide a convenient means for attaching fluorescent labels or biotins to antibodies and larger proteins. These kits are ideal for use with multiple applications, including flow cytometry, fluorescent microscopy, immunohistochemistry, primary detection, ELISAs, immunocytochemistry, and FISH. These systems are available with a variety of dye colors, biotin, fluorescent agents, and all the components needed to perform multiple conjugations and purifications. Protein labeling follows a simple protocol of reaction, separation, and then use.

HOOK™ Biotin-Hydrazide and its long spacer arm equivalent, HOOK™ Biotin-LC-Hydrazide, are carbohydrate reactive reagents. HOOK™ carbohydrate reactive biotin reagents react with oxidised carbohydrate side chains. Some biotin reagents do not bind directly to the protein itself, but instead, conjugate to the carbohydrate residues of glycoproteins. The carbohydrate reactive biotin reagents contain hydrazides (-NH-NH₂) as a reactive group. The hydrazide reactions require carbonyl groups, such as aldehydes and ketones, which are formed by oxidative treatment of the carbohydrates. Hydrazides react spontaneously with carbonyl groups, forming a stable hydrazone bond. These reagents are particularly suitable for labelling and studying glycosylated proteins, such as antibodies and receptors.

FITC (fluorescein isothiocyanate) is a commonly used fluorescent label for proteins, as it contains the groups required for conjugating to amino, sulfhydryl, imidazoyl, tyrosyl or carbonyl groups of proteins. FITC has a molecular weight of 389, and excitation and emission wavelengths of 494 nm and 520 nm, respectively, therefore emitting green visible light.

The DyLight™ Long Stokes Shift Dyes are amine-reactive fluorescent dyes that produce long Stokes (LS) shifts of 80 to 145 nm in excitation/emission wavelengths. The DyLight™ LS dyes provide multicolour detection using a single excitation source in applications including flow cytometry, conjugation, DNA-sequencing, microscopy and fluorescence in situ hybridization (FISH). These dyes contain N-hydroxysuccinimide (NHS) esters, the most commonly used reactive group for labeling proteins. NHS esters react with primary amines on proteins and other molecules, forming a stable, covalent amide bond and releasing the NHS group.
